Report: The Crew lead designer confident of stable launch

0

Glitches and save issues have plagued Ubisoft’s most recent prominent releases, but The Crew‘s lead game designer, Serkan Hasan, has told The Metropolist that the upcoming social racer should have a smooth ride out of the gate. Aside from urging players to expect the Xbox One, PS4 and PC versions to be fully capable of 1080p and 30 fps at launch, Hasan also shared no reservations about the stability of The Crew‘s online features.

Hasan explained that he harbors confidence because The Crew has “reaped the benefits of a long term beta program, designed specifically to push our infrastructure as far as possible in real world situations, with thousands of players from all over the world playing the game at the same time.”

Hasan’s comments follow a post to the Ubiblog which stated that copies of The Crew were not sent to press in advance due to an assessment of its true experience requiring “thousands and thousands and thousands of players – something that can’t be simulated with a handful of devs playing alongside the press.”

Bungie mentioned a similar philosophy before it launched Destiny, with review copies being held until the socially-focused shooter’s public audience arrived on opening day. Opinions were mixed concerning Destiny‘s loot-fueled adventure, but at least the push to become top Guardian was a mostly-stable affair.
